Best Taylor County Public Middle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 254 students in Taylor County, GA.
The top-ranked public middle school in Taylor County, GA is Taylor County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Taylor County, GA public middle school have an average math proficiency score of 22% (versus the Georgia public middle school average of 35%), and reading proficiency score of 24% (versus the 39% statewide average). Middle schools in Taylor County have an average ranking of 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Georgia public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 52% of the student body (majority Black), which is less than the Georgia public middle school average of 66% (majority Black).
